Python 获取包含Selenium的页面,但等待元素值不为空
我正在使用Selenium抓取一个网页,但我需要等待加载某个值。我不知道这个值是什么,只知道它将出现在什么元素中 似乎使用预期条件Python 获取包含Selenium的页面,但等待元素值不为空,python,selenium,selenium-webdriver,Python,Selenium,Selenium Webdriver,我正在使用Selenium抓取一个网页,但我需要等待加载某个值。我不知道这个值是什么,只知道它将出现在什么元素中 似乎使用预期条件text\u to\u present\u in_element\u value或text\u to\u present\u in_element是最有可能的方法,但我很难找到任何关于如何使用这些的实际文档,我不知道它们是在页面获取之前还是之后出现: webdriver.get(url) 这两者的关联答案都依赖于知道预期的文本值。在第一个调用中,它显式地显示了硬编
text\u to\u present\u in_element\u value
或text\u to\u present\u in_element
是最有可能的方法,但我很难找到任何关于如何使用这些的实际文档,我不知道它们是在页面获取之前还是之后出现:
webdriver.get(url)
这两者的关联答案都依赖于知道预期的文本值。在第一个调用中,它显式地显示了硬编码到
WebDriverWait
调用中的预期文本。此外,两个链接的答案都没有触及我问题的最后部分:
[无论]他们是在页面获取之前还是之后
我不知道为什么这被标记为重复问题。这两个相关问题的答案都依赖于知道文本值将是什么,我在这里明确地说,我不知道文本值将是什么。所以说“如果这些问题不能解决您的问题,请问一个新问题”,所以我想我会再次发布完全相同的问题,希望有人在这次结束之前阅读。新问题: